Ensuring Equity and Access in AI-Driven Healthcare

One of the most pressing ethical concerns surrounding AI in US healthcare is its potential to exacerbate existing health disparities or create new ones. AI algorithms are trained on vast datasets, and if these datasets are not representative of the diverse American population, the resulting AI tools may perform less accurately for certain demographic groups, particularly racial and ethnic minorities, women, and individuals from lower socioeconomic backgrounds. This can lead to misdiagnoses, suboptimal treatment recommendations, and ultimately, poorer health outcomes for already underserved communities. For instance, an AI diagnostic tool trained predominantly on data from white male patients might fail to accurately detect early signs of disease in women or individuals with darker skin tones. Federal and state policies must therefore prioritize the development and validation of AI systems using diverse and inclusive datasets. Initiatives like the National Institutes of Health’s All of Us Research Program, which aims to collect health data from one million people across the US, are crucial steps in this direction. A practical tip for developers and policymakers is to mandate rigorous bias testing and ongoing performance monitoring of AI algorithms across all relevant demographic subgroups before widespread adoption.

The Criticality of Data Privacy and Security in AI Healthcare

The power of AI in healthcare is intrinsically linked to the vast amounts of sensitive patient data it processes. Protecting this data from breaches, unauthorized access, and misuse is paramount. The Health Insurance Portability and Accountability Act (HIPAA) provides a foundational framework for patient privacy in the US, but the unique challenges posed by AI necessitate a re-evaluation and potential strengthening of these regulations. AI systems can infer highly personal information from seemingly innocuous data points, raising concerns about re-identification and the potential for discriminatory practices by insurers or employers. Furthermore, the increasing use of cloud-based AI platforms introduces new vulnerabilities that require robust cybersecurity measures. A significant statistic to consider is the rising number of healthcare data breaches, which have exposed millions of patient records annually. Policymakers must consider implementing stricter guidelines for data anonymization, consent mechanisms for AI-driven data usage, and clear accountability frameworks for AI developers and healthcare providers in the event of a data breach. Establishing clear protocols for data governance and ensuring transparency in how patient data is utilized by AI systems are essential for building and maintaining public trust.

Accountability and Transparency in AI Decision-Making

As AI systems become more sophisticated and autonomous in clinical decision-making, questions of accountability arise. When an AI makes an incorrect diagnosis or recommends a harmful treatment, who is responsible? Is it the AI developer, the healthcare institution that deployed the system, or the clinician who relied on the AI’s recommendation? The “black box” nature of some advanced AI algorithms, where the reasoning process is not easily interpretable, further complicates this issue. In the US, legal frameworks are still evolving to address AI-related medical malpractice. Transparency in AI decision-making is crucial for building trust among patients and clinicians. This involves developing AI systems that can provide explanations for their recommendations, allowing clinicians to critically evaluate the AI’s output rather than blindly accepting it. A practical approach is to advocate for “explainable AI” (XAI) techniques in healthcare settings. For example, a radiologist using an AI tool for detecting lung nodules should be able to understand why the AI flagged a particular area, enabling them to confirm or refute the finding with greater confidence. Policy discussions should focus on establishing clear lines of responsibility and promoting the development of interpretable AI models.
